The current scenario surrounding Bitcoin represents a departure from past halving cycles. The intersection of institutional adoption, successful ETFs, and the unwavering confidence of long-term holders creates a unique environment poised for significant market shifts.
Institutional Adoption: The surge in institutional interest and investment in Bitcoin ETFs signifies a notable shift in the perception of cryptocurrencies as a legitimate asset class. This institutional involvement not only boosts demand but also lends credibility to Bitcoin as a store of value and hedge against traditional financial markets.
Confidence Among Long-Term Holders: The steadfast belief of long-term Bitcoin holders highlights the resilience of the cryptocurrency and its underlying technology. Despite market volatility, these holders remain committed to Bitcoin’s value proposition, contributing to its overall scarcity and reinforcing its position in the market.
Dynamic of Short-Term Holders: The increase in supply held by short-term holders indicates heightened market activity and trading volume, potentially signaling growing interest and participation from retail investors. While short-term fluctuations may introduce volatility, they also reflect the dynamic nature of Bitcoin’s market and its ability to attract diverse investor profiles.

Q: What is the Bitcoin halving? A: The Bitcoin halving is an event programmed into Bitcoin’s code that occurs approximately every four years. During the halving, the reward that miners receive for validating transactions on the Bitcoin network is cut in half.
Q: How does the halving impact Bitcoin’s price? A: Historically, Bitcoin halving events have been associated with significant price increases due to the reduction in the rate at which new Bitcoins are created. This reduction in supply, combined with sustained or increasing demand, can lead to upward price pressure.
Q: Why is this halving different? A: This halving is unique due to the unprecedented institutional adoption of Bitcoin, particularly through the success of Bitcoin ETFs. Additionally, the confidence of long-term holders and the surge in short-term holder supply contribute to a potentially bullish scenario post-halving.
